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$34,670 |
25th Percentile Wage | $40,800 |
50th Percentile Wage | $53,270 |
75th Percentile Wage | $61,150 |
90th Percentile Wage | $69,000 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for mechanical engineering technicians in the industry of glass and glass product manufacturing.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) mechanical engineering technicians is $69,000.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$53,270.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ent mechanical engineering technicians is $34,670.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of mechanical engineering technicians in the industry of Glass and Glass Product Manufacturing from 2012 to 2016.
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 4-Year Growth |
---|---|---|---|
2016 | $53,270 | -2.70% | 6.08% |
2015 | $54,710 | 2.32% | - |
2014 | $53,440 | 3.52% | - |
2013 | $51,560 | 2.97% | - |
2012 | $50,030 | - | - |
